CHARLESTON, S.C. (AP) -- A father and his 10-year-old son were able to walk away after their small plane crashed in marshland in Mount Pleasant.
Mount Pleasant Police Sgt. R.H. Googe told The Post and Courier of Charleston that the plane landed flat on its belly Saturday afternoon. He says the pilot and his son were muddy, but didn't appear to be injured.
Witnesses say the banked before going down.
After the crash, the plane sunk into the mud, leaving only its tail visible.
Federal officials will investigate the crash, and environment agents are monitoring the scene for any fuel leaks
The name of the pilot has not been released.
